October 2023 by Wendy P
HUGE selection of fall decor - pumpkins, mums and corn stalks outside. Very good prices - mums were $6, $12 and $18 (I think) for sm, med and lg. Inside a cute country store with and especially varied menu. We had the daily special which was awesome - cheeseburger, fries and drink - for $11. Definitely worth the short drive there.

April 2021 by Rob S.
If this isn't the definition of hidden gem then nothing really is. This place is quite literally in the middle of nowhere. Nothing for miles in any direction. Really cool set up, outside is set up with potted plants that are for sale (see pics) and a pseudo farmers market (not tons of stuff, but some fresh farm grown produce). When you go inside they have a small general store that has some staples (I'm guessing for people that live in the area so they don't have to drive to get something the need).But, the star of the show is the food!! It's not a huge expansive menu, but what they have they do it well. My wife went for a pimento burger and added some customizations such as a fried green tomato and bacon. I went for another one of the burgers, the spicy cow - double beef patty, pepper jack cheese, grilled onions and jalapenos (had to add bacon to this one). Nothing about this is small....overflowing with toppings and cooked to blistering hot perfection. This burger really delivers a flavor experience. This place is 100% legit and the prices are good too! Check these guys out, they are worth the drive out to the middle of nowhere.
